Employ a One-Time Email : Secure Your Privacy Online

Navigating the digital world necessitates careful consideration of your online privacy. Every interaction, from signing up for websites to engaging in forums, can potentially expose your personal information. A smart strategy to mitigate this risk is leveraging a disposable email address. These temporary accounts provide a buffer between your primary email and the flood of online requests, safeguarding your real identity and minimizing potential threats.

  • Furthermore, disposable emails can be helpful in stopping spam and phishing attempts. By providing a temporary address, you lower the chances of your inbox becoming overwhelmed with unwanted communications.
  • Think about situations where you need to sign up for a service but are hesitant to share your primary email. A disposable address offers a protected solution in such cases, allowing you to access the service without putting at risk your privacy.

In conclusion, embracing disposable emails is a wise step towards strengthening your online privacy. It provides a reliable layer of protection against the risks lurking in the digital realm.

Registration with an Emphasis on Privacy

In today's digital landscape, safeguarding your privacy is paramount. When registering for online services or platforms, it's crucial to minimize the amount of personal information you divulge. A common practice employed by privacy-conscious individuals is utilizing temporary email addresses. These throwaway email accounts offer a secure method to shield your primary email address from potential spam, harmful actors, and data breaches. By registering with a temporary email, you create a barrier between your real identity and online interactions, reducing the risk of your personal information falling into the inappropriate hands.

  • Opting for a temporary email address can provide a layer of anonymity during online registration processes.
  • These addresses often expire after a set period, eliminating the need to constantly manage multiple inboxes.
  • Numerous reputable providers offer trustworthy temporary email services, ensuring your privacy is protected throughout your online journey.

Embracing temporary email addresses can empower you to navigate the digital world with greater confidence and control over your personal information.
